Lawro & Mystic Mug - Villa Win + Match Build Up

Lawro, hot on the heels of a correct draw prediction v Arsenal (the game was 0-0, he said 1-1) is saying an away win for Villa against Fulham this weekend.

The BBC pundit has backed Villa to win 2-1 saying: 'Fulham have struggled on the road all season, winning only one game, but they have obviously been solid at home.'

Adding, 'But they have just hit a bit of a rocky patch, and Villa got a good point at home against Arsenal in midweek, so I'm going for a rare home defeat for Fulham.'
